Porcelain has a Mohs hardness of approximately 6-7, making it a relatively hard material. This hardness allows porcelain to be used as a streak plate in mineral testing to determine the color of a mineral's powder when scratched against it.
The Japanese started the production of porcelain in the early seventeenth century. The Chinese already invented it several hundred years before the Japanese, during the Tang dynasty.
